Best Men's Rowing Programs, Ranked by Resources

Not every program invests equally in its athletes. Below, we've ranked all 61 men's Rowing programs by investment score — a composite built from estimated aid per athlete, operating budget, and coaching staff size relative to its peers.

Average aid across men's Rowing programs is $19,912 per athlete, with an average operating budget of $224,247, and rosters of about 42 athletes. Programs near the top tend to combine larger budgets with stronger per-athlete support.
